Thomas Cook mulls over peak booking ad campaign

Saturday, 19 Sep, 2014 0

Thomas Cook has yet to decide if and when to launch a TV ad campaign to promote its summer 2015 programme, claimed new UK managing director Salman Syed.

Rival Thomson has launched its new summer 2015 advertising campaign several months early, with its first ads due to appear on cinema screens today and on TV tomorrow during X-Factor.

However, Syed said details of Thomas Cook’s advertising strategy for summer 2015 were still being finalised and he said it had not yet been decided if the operator would run television adverts over the peak post-Christmas period.

He said its summer 2015 campaign would continue along the lines of its ’emotionally-led’ multichannel  ‘We Love New Experiences’ campaign, launched for winter 2014.

For this winter, Thomas Cook has added La Gomera in the Canaries and it will also offer holidays to Morocco for the first time during winter. It will also continue offering Cape Verde, which was introduced last February.
